Publix Super Markets - Old Village Publix
Publix Super Markets - Old Village Publix is a Grocers & Supermarkets company at Englewood,Florida,United States , Tel is (941)473-5441,address is 55 North Indiana Avenue.You can find more Publix Super Markets - Old Village Publix contact info like fax,email,website below.